Output 186b4ca37775f729081711692b9accd1d7aa1148f0607821f7b151d794706218:1

value
50110570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776e6d89b535f4b74201707ef604203f20c6000a OP_EQUAL
address
3CaWd31D25RQPyq6ZAm7PVUPuHkHZYn3TU
transaction
186b4ca37775f729081711692b9accd1d7aa1148f0607821f7b151d794706218
confirmations
461556
spent
true